About the company

This facility provides multiple care services including Dementia, Palliative & Respite care. They are part of a larger organisation which is based nationwide across Australia. They are one of the largest Aged Care providers in Australia. They focus on providing the best quality of life for their residents and being the voice for the residents within their care.

About the opportunity

This position is available as soon as possible and they are looking for a strong clinically focused Registered Nurse with experience in Aged Care Management. You will report to the Regional Manager and be responsible for the day to day operational management of the site. This is an opportunity to become part of one of Aged Care leading providers in Australia and they are very supportive and provide internal training for career development. This role is perfect for a passionate Aged Care senior manager looking for a role to keep them challenged.

Duties

  • Daily overall management of the facility
  • Provide leadership & mentorship to staff members
  • Ensure resident lifestyle & care needs are met
  • Ensure quality & accreditation guidelines are met
  • Support of ACFI process
  • Actively promote a culture of excellence

Skills and Experience

  • Current unrestricted AHPRA Registration
  • Tertiary Qualifications in Nursing, Health management or a related subject
  • Excellent communication and people management skills
  • Minimum of three years (recent) experience within a similar position
  • At least five years' post grad experience working as a Registered Nurse
  • Sound clinical skills and ACFI & Accreditation experience and knowledge
  • Proven experience with evaluating clinical documentation and work practices so compliance is achieved
  • Good leadership skills and positive, can do attitude!
  • Experience with finance management, HR & staff leadership
